In many different cultures, Mary tattoo design is the most popular design. This tattoo design is the only design which expresses their love and faith on a spiritual level. For Christians, Mary is an important person. Jesus was conceived by Mary with the help of the Holy Spirit. Before conceiving baby Jesus, Mary is believed to be a virgin. And that’s why she is called the Virgin Mary.

This neo-classical left arm sleeve tattoo features fantastic depictions of Mary and Jesus Christ . The depth and strength of each character’s features, which are linked by a rose in the middle, are nearly flawless. It’s the work done on the central flower that separates this piece from being merely very good to epic. The tattoo artist has demonstrated an impressive command of negative space to work shade variations tightly throughout.

This is top quality chest body art having Mother Mary in tears before her crucified son at Golgotha. This religious tattoo does an exceptional flip by using Mary’s scarf in a heavily patterned and detailed part of the ink. The clarity in linework and pattern is beautiful. I also like how the central headscarf helps bridge the two sections. It’s a busier and more delicate pattern against the grim view of the three men crucified on one side and the beautiful, mourning mother on the other.
